Welcome to the Pointsmith ledger. Capacity planning is mostly about write amplification: every earn/burn event lands in the append log, a balance cache, and a daily rollup. Reads are cheap; compaction is not. We size partitions off peak redemption hours, not averages, and keep 40% headroom for promo spikes. Before touching partition counts, check the current tuning constants, shown below.

tuning table, hafog-bahaf:
QUOTAS = {
    "praion": 144,
    "briax": 906,
    "silwyn": 451,
}

Subject: On-call handover — Wikivault access roles

Hi — handing over the Wikivault rotation. Main open item: the role-based access migration is half done. Editors in the Fennick space were moved to the new "contributor" role, but the legacy "author" role still grants write access, so audit reports show duplicates. Don't delete the legacy role yet; two automation accounts still depend on it. The migration runbook is pinned in the admin space. If anyone reports lost edit access during the switchover, route them to the access team.

pager mailbox: druwyn@norvaio.corp

First-day checklist — item 6: Locate the first-aid room. At Oakmere House this is on Level 1, opposite the Willowbrook meeting suite, marked with a green cross. Walk the route from your assigned work area so you can find it quickly in an emergency. The room is kept locked to protect medical supplies; entry for contractors and staff is by keypad. The current entry code appears below.

turnstile pass: bdg-YPPQB-52010

MEMO — Sales Leads Only

The lease on the Marleton Yard office is up for renegotiation. Landlord wants a 14% uplift; we're countering at 4% with a five-year term. Dena Farro leads negotiations. Until settled, make no commitments to clients about on-site demos at Marleton after Q2. Flag any deals that assume that space. Expect resolution within six weeks. Keep this off client calls entirely. The outcome feeds directly into our footprint decision, which is summarised below.

confidential, kagup-bafog: Fraaxax Group is in early talks to buy Soroxox Group for about $343.8 million. The Olidor launch date is June 14, and nothing goes to the press before then. Legal wants the Aldmirek Logistics term sheet signed before July 23.